Here are some highlights your host may include during your experience:
Pass by without stopping
Sydney Town Hall
Begin at Sydney Town Hall, completed in the late 19th century and built above one of the city’s earliest burial grounds. Its ornate sandstone façade reflects a time when Sydney was establishing itself as a major colonial city, while the surrounding streets reflect the city’s modern pace.
Pass by without stopping
The Rocks
Walk through The Rocks, the site of the first European settlement in Australia. Narrow laneways and sandstone buildings trace the city’s earliest years, while layers of redevelopment reveal how the area has evolved from a working-class district into a preserved historic quarter.
Pass by without stopping
Circular Quay
Arrive at Circular Quay, once a vital shipping port and now the center of Sydney’s transport and harbor life. Ferry routes still follow paths established over a century ago, and the constant movement across the water reflects the city’s enduring connection to its harbor.
Pass by without stopping
Royal Botanic Garden Sydney
Continue into the Royal Botanic Garden, established in 1816 as the country’s first scientific institution. Set along the harbor, it combines curated landscapes with native plant collections, offering insight into both Australia’s environment and the city’s early development.
Pass by without stopping
Surry Hills
Finish in Surry Hills, a neighborhood that reflects Sydney’s evolution over time. Once industrial and working-class, it is now known for its independent cafés, small galleries, and creative businesses, offering a clear view of the city’s contemporary identity.
